Uttar Pradesh is reeling under an intense heatwave. On Monday, Jhansi and Agra recorded 45.9°C, making them the second hottest places in the country after Sri Ganganagar, Rajasthan (47.3°C).

🔹 Heatwave Alerts Across 19 Districts

The Meteorological Department has issued heatwave warnings for districts like Prayagraj, Varanasi, Kanpur, and Mirzapur. Atul Kumar Singh from Lucknow Weather Centre noted that light showers might begin in eastern UP post June 11.

🔹 Power Demand Breaks Records

With rising temperatures, electricity demand has peaked. On June 8 night, UP saw a record power demand of 30,161 MW. This may reach 32,000 MW in the coming weeks.

🔹 Parents Demand School Holiday Extension

Despite extreme weather, schools are scheduled to reopen on June 16. Parents and teachers are urging CM Yogi Adityanath to extend holidays till June 30, citing risks to children’s health.
